Intern OpportunityWe are seeking a motivated, detail-oriented intern to support global category management and procurement analytics initiatives. This role offers hands-on experience in a multinational procurement environment, focusing on data clean-up and validation, standardized processes for new part introductions (NPI), and the development of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to measure procurement performance across factories. The intern will collaborate with global category owners, regional procurement leaders, and IT teams to enhance data quality, streamline workflows, and support analytics and reporting.Key ResponsibilitiesAnalyze, clean, and validate category and procurement data to ensure accuracy and consistency across global systems. Design and implement standardized workflows for NPI and part maintenance, focusing on part categorization. Define and document required data fields for category and subcategory assignments in new part introductions. Develop clear KPI definitions, calculation methods, targets, and data governance standards for procurement metrics (e.g., on-time delivery, cost variance, quality, supplier lead time). Create and maintain data templates, validation rules, and supporting documentation (SOPs, training materials) for consistent data input and reporting. Gather and distribute global Purchase Price Variance (PPV) and other procurement performance reports to stakeholders. Support pilot implementations of new standards and capture feedback for continuous improvement. Collaborate cross-functionally with IT, procurement, and category management teams to align standards and improve processes. Present findings, recommendations, and pilot outcomes to stakeholders.Key ProjectsAssign attributes to key purchased parts across the organization. Develop and maintain dashboards for PPV, VAVE, and spend reporting. Lead the design and implementation of standardized workflows for NPI and part maintenance, with emphasis on category and subcategory data fields. Create and maintain data templates, validation rules, and documentation (SOPs, training materials) to support consistent data input and reporting. Develop clear KPI definitions, calculation methods, targets, and data governance standards for key procurement metrics such as on-time delivery and quality.QualificationsCurrently enrolled in a Bachelor's or Master's program in Business, Supply Chain Management, Data Analytics, Industrial Engineering, or a related field. Strong analytical skills with excellent attention to detail and commitment to data accuracy. Proficiency in Microsoft Excel; familiarity with Power BI, Tableau, SQL, Python, or ERP/MRP systems is a plus. Effective written and verbal communication skills; comfortable presenting to stakeholders.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a global team environment. Interest or prior coursework/experience in procurement, category management, data modeling, or process improvement is desirable.What You'll Take Away From This ExperiencePractical exposure to global procurement operations and category management analytics.
